During the 1990s, the name Mike Tyson became synonymous with both athletic prowess and personal struggles. His meteoric rise to fame and fortune attracted numerous individuals who sought to exploit his wealth and influence. Moreover, his promoter Don King was among the most notorious figures to allegedly capitalize on Tyson’s vulnerability.
Amid legal battles, ‘Iron’ Mike accused King of deception and fraud, claiming that he had been robbed of a significant portion of his earnings. He even went on to sue the boxing promoter for $100 million, which he won after both parties settled. However, time has shown that Tyson’s indomitable spirit cannot be permanently overshadowed by past grievances.

Mike Tyson speaks up on his journey toward being independent
In a recent episode of his podcast Hotboxin’, along with rapper Trippie Redd the former boxing champion expressed happiness with his newfound independence. He also reflected on the obstacles he faced and the people who took advantage of him. Tyson’s words captured both a sense of empowerment and a desire to take control of his destiny.
“I’m happy I’m independent. I got my own, shooting that before and I was fighting ni**as. Stealing sh*t, playing me for shit. Ni**as getting my cheque before I do. Sh*t like that. Now it’s all about me. I’m here, talking sh*t with ni**as like you. I know it’s gonna get over 2 million hits,” he said.

From financial setbacks to thriving entrepreneurship: Mike Tyson’s remarkable business ventures
Mike Tyson’s business is projected to make an astounding $160 million in 2023. His financial success showcases his ability to rise above setbacks. Additionally, his strategic partnerships, including collaborations with former Israeli Prime Minister Ehud Barak, illustrate his ability to forge lucrative alliances. This, combined with his already successful cannabis business, has certainly made ‘Iron’ Mike a force to be reckoned with in the business world.
